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,324,095,814
Lastest Block:
1,960,917
Utxos:
1,983,748
Nodes:
375
OmniXEP Contracts:
274
Block details
[STAKE]
03/09/2024 20:52:32 UTC
Txid
1dcd22b46f508eba6e3875a86c1829a142ae41172871e3bb7a4681ef63fe5fdb
Block
1,454,867
Block hash
5d4c7551603cf7134ae6452a2f6a68f2e60a878f1c3534dda847f062e50b5eb8
Stake amount
155.30720484 XEP
Sender
ep1qd7tnamrpw2pnsy55xxll4r3c80r5x36ydksz4u
Recipient
ep1qmqv36ncaly24ku40gfs3qe6sccrv7hjspe784d
(2,100,640.99509084 XEP)